Former Disney CEO and Jared Kushner’s brother buying Los Angeles Lakers
Bob Iger, the former chief executive of Disney, and Joshua Kushner, the younger brother of Jared Kushner, are moving to buy the Los Angeles Lakers basketball team for $12 billion.The NBA franchise was last bought by billionaire businessman Mark Walter for $10 billion last year. He now wishes to relinquish his majority stake in the team. “We have immense respect for the leadership and vision of Jerry and Jeanie Buss.
